Complementary & Non-Prescription Options These products are often used in conjunction with the above medications or for those with milder hair thinning. Nutrafol: Why: Nutrafol will likely remain a leader in the science-backed supplement space. They offer physician-formulated nutraceuticals (Nutrafol Men, Nutrafol Women) designed to target multiple root causes of thinning hair, such as stress, inflammation, and hormone imbalances, using botanical ingredients. While not a direct substitute for FDA-approved medications, they are highly regarded as an effective complementary therapy to improve overall hair health and density. They offer a subscription model directly from their website. iRestore Hair Growth System / CapillusRx: Why: Low-Level Laser Therapy (LLLT) devices will continue to be a popular non-invasive option. Brands like iRestore and CapillusRx offer FDA-cleared laser caps and helmets that you can use at home. These devices aim to stimulate hair follicles and promote hair growth by increasing blood flow. They are generally safe, easy to use, and can be a good addition to a regimen, especially for those looking for drug-free options or to enhance the effects of other treatments. You can purchase these directly online. Important Considerations for 2026: Combination Therapy: Expect online platforms to increasingly offer and recommend personalized combination therapies (e.g., finasteride + minoxidil + a specific shampoo/supplement) for maximum efficacy. Topical Finasteride: While currently available, topical finasteride (which aims to reduce systemic side effects) might become even more widely available and refined through these online platforms by 2026. Consistency is Key: No matter the treatment, consistency will remain the most crucial factor for seeing results. Hair growth is a slow process. Consult a Doctor: Always start with an online consultation (provided by the above platforms) to ensure the treatment is appropriate for your type of hair loss and to discuss potential side effects.
